Kishorpur

Kishorpur is a village located in Bishnupur Ii subdivision of South Twenty Four Parganas district in West Bengal, India. It is situated 6.9km away from sub-district headquarter Bakrahat (tehsildar office) and 26.1km away from district headquarter Alipore. As per 2009 stats, Panchanan is the gram panchayat of Kishorpur village.

About Kishorpur

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kishorpur is 333513. The village spans a total geographical area of 133.27 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 743503. Thakurpukur is nearest town to Kishorpur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 12km away.

Population of Kishorpur

Below is a concise population overview of Kishorpur as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 2,094 1,064 1,030
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 175 97 78
Scheduled Castes (SC) 9 6 3
Scheduled Tribes (ST) N/A N/A N/A
Literate Population 1,648 859 789
Illiterate Population 446 205 241

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Kishorpur village:

  • The total population of Kishorpur village is around 2,094, including approximately 1,064 males and 1,030 females, with a sex ratio of 968 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 175 children aged 0–6 years in Kishorpur village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Kishorpur village has 9 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C).
  • The literacy rate of Kishorpur village is about 78.70%, with male literacy at 80.73% and female literacy at 76.60%.
  • There are around 514 households in Kishorpur village.

Connectivity of Kishorpur

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kishorpur. As per the 2011 stats, Kishorpur had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
